  2. Hola all.... just thought I would share an interesting find about T2000 - and how to beat the highscore - or better - how to skip those unwanted levels... Ok, we all know those levels in T2000 we really don't like. We know the game, we play it, we beat it (or not !!). But there are alwos the levels we crave the least. if you are ever facing one of the levels you really don't dig and you are not in the mood to beat, just do the following: just KEEP the B button pressed at the beginning of your least favourite level and DON"T MOVE your pod !!!!. Every enemy wil dissapppear once it touches your pod (after reaching your end of the grid and wandering around for a while ) - and you will get earn points for each pod that you "destroyed". Once you move or realease the B button the magic is gone... and without moving eventually the level will be over.... This has probably been heard at AA before.   5. The world is good again. I checked this web page with the repair tips & hints and tried the screwdriver method. So I just "squeezed" the platter up by turing the screwdriver and rotating the platter while doing that. Did this procedure until the platter was moving freely. Now I have a QUITLY working JagCD Thanks guys for your help!!!!!!!
